This module is able to configure a FortiManager device by allowing the user to [ get set update ] the following apis.
/cli/global/system/ha
Examples include all parameters and values need to be adjusted to data sources before usage.
- hosts: fortimanager-inventory collections: - fortinet.fortimanager connection: httpapi vars: ansible_httpapi_use_ssl: True ansible_httpapi_validate_certs: False ansible_httpapi_port: 443 tasks: - name: REQUESTING /CLI/SYSTEM/HA fmgr_system_ha: loose_validation: False workspace_locking_adom: <value in [global, custom adom]> workspace_locking_timeout: 300 method: <value in [set, update]> params: - data: clusterid: <value of integer> file-quota: <value of integer> hb-interval: <value of integer> hb-lost-threshold: <value of integer> mode: <value in [standalone, master, slave]> password: - <value of string> peer: - id: <value of integer> ip: <value of string> ip6: <value of string> serial-number: <value of string> status: <value in [disable, enable]>
method: choices: - get - set - update description: - The method in request required: true type: str params: description: - The parameters for each method - See full parameters list in https://ansible-galaxy-fortimanager-docs.readthedocs.io/en/latest required: false type: list url_params: description: - The parameters for each API request URL - Also see full URL parameters in https://ansible-galaxy-fortimanager-docs.readthedocs.io/en/latest required: false type: dict loose_validation: description: - Do parameter validation in a loose way required: false type: bool workspace_locking_adom: description: - the adom name to lock in case FortiManager running in workspace mode - it can be global or any other custom adom names required: false type: str workspace_locking_timeout: default: 300 description: - the maximum time in seconds to wait for other user to release the workspace lock required: false type: int
data: description: The payload returned in the request returned: always type: dict status: description: The status of api request returned: always type: dict url: description: The full url requested returned: always sample: /sys/login/user type: str
